GSA National is Hiring a Financial Analyst Near Fairfax, VA

GSA National has an exciting opportunity to join us as a Financial Analyst. The Financial Analyst prepares client invoices, vouchers, retirement funding reports, and other client-related reports.

GSA National, an Accretive company, has been helping government contractors ensure compliance and streamline costs since 1991, by specializing in the design, management, and administration of employee benefit programs for government contractors. GSA National provides fringe benefits administration, consulting, compliance services to many of the industry’s leading contractors. For more information about us, please visit www.gsanational.com.

What You'll Do

  • Collect, validate, and analyze client data files for processing with GSA systems while ensuring data integrity.
  • Prepare client health and welfare funding invoices and verification schedules for GSA National management review.
  • Reconcile client source data to final hours, contributions and fringe benefit credits invoiced to client.
  • Use critical thinking skills to apply fringe benefit reporting requirements under Service Contract Act, Davis Bacon Act, and collective bargaining agreements.
  • Perform variance analytics to identify and explain changes between accounting periods for management review.
  • Prepare client reporting deliverables including retirement funding reports.
  • Communicate nuanced fringe benefits compliance concepts in a manner that can be understood by clients, vendors, carriers, and co-workers.
  • Handle client inquiries with the highest degree of responsiveness and professionalism.
  • Assist with the implementation of health and welfare invoicing processes for new clients.
  • Other duties as assigned.
